Biography of Matthew Grey Gubler
Matthew Grey Gubler is an American actor, filmmaker, painter, and author, renowned for his multifaceted talents and charismatic persona. Born on March 9, 1980, in Las Vegas, Nevada, he is the son of Marilyn, a rancher, and John Gubler, an attorney. His early interest in performing arts led him to pursue a career in acting, while his passion for visual arts found expression through painting and filmmaking. Gubler's diverse talents have earned him a prominent place in the entertainment industry, captivating audiences worldwide.
Attribute | Details |
---|---|
Full Name | Matthew Grey Gubler |
Date of Birth | March 9, 1980 |
Place of Birth | Las Vegas, Nevada, USA |
Profession | Actor, Director, Painter, Author |
Education | Tisch School of the Arts, New York University |
Notable Work | "Criminal Minds" |

Matthew Grey Gubler's Academic Pursuits and Education
Matthew Grey Gubler's academic journey began in Las Vegas, where he attended the Las Vegas Academy of International Studies, Performing and Visual Arts. This specialized high school provided Gubler with a platform to explore his artistic talents, allowing him to participate in various theater productions and visual art projects. It was here that Gubler's passion for the arts truly began to flourish.
After graduating from high school, Gubler moved to New York City to attend the prestigious Tisch School of the Arts at New York University. At Tisch, Gubler majored in film directing, a decision that would later prove instrumental in his career. How Did Matthew Grey Gubler Begin His Career?
Matthew Grey Gubler's career began with a serendipitous encounter while he was an intern at Wes Anderson's film "The Life Aquatic with Steve Zissou." Anderson recognized Gubler's potential and encouraged him to pursue acting, a suggestion that would prove to be pivotal in Gubler's career. This opportunity marked the beginning of his journey in the entertainment industry, opening doors to a world of possibilities.
Gubler's first significant acting role came in 2005 when he was cast as Dr. Spencer Reid in the CBS television series "Criminal Minds." The show, which follows a team of FBI profilers as they solve complex criminal cases, provided Gubler with a platform to showcase his acting talents. His portrayal of Dr. Reid, a brilliant yet socially awkward genius, resonated with audiences and quickly became a fan favorite.
In addition to his work on "Criminal Minds," Gubler also pursued other acting opportunities, appearing in films such as "500 Days of Summer" and "Life After Beth." Exploring Matthew Grey Gubler's Filmography
While Matthew Grey Gubler is best known for his work on "Criminal Minds," his filmography includes a diverse array of roles that showcase his versatility as an actor. Gubler has appeared in numerous films, ranging from romantic comedies to horror movies, each offering him the opportunity to explore different facets of his craft.
One of Gubler's notable film roles was in the 2009 romantic comedy "500 Days of Summer," where he played the character of Paul. The film, which was well-received by both critics and audiences, allowed Gubler to demonstrate his comedic timing and chemistry with his co-stars. His performance in the film was praised for its authenticity and charm, further establishing him as a talented actor.
In addition to romantic comedies, Gubler has also ventured into the horror genre, starring in films such as "Suburban Gothic" and "Life After Beth." Matthew Grey Gubler as an Author
In recent years, Matthew Grey Gubler has expanded his creative repertoire by penning his first book, "Rumple Buttercup: A Story of Bananas, Belonging, and Being Yourself." Released in 2019, the book is a whimsical tale about embracing one's uniqueness and finding a sense of belonging, themes that resonate deeply with readers of all ages.
"Rumple Buttercup" showcases Gubler's distinctive storytelling style, blending humor, heart, and imaginative illustrations to create a captivating narrative. The book was met with critical acclaim, praised for its positive message and charming artwork.
